写在前面
笔者是一个初学者,仅仅从初学者角度为大家提供一些解法思路,因此并不能保证代码的质量
如果不符合你的要求,欢迎你参考其他人更加优秀的代码,谢谢!
我将持续更新,欢迎关注!
目录
第一讲 基本概念
最大子列和问题
Maximum Subsequence Sum
二分查找
第二讲 线性结构
两个有序链表序列的合并
一元多项式的乘法与加法运算
Reversing Linked List
Pop Sequence
第三讲 树(上)
树的同构
List Leaves
Tree Traversals Again
第四讲 树(中)
是否同一棵二叉搜索树
Root of AVL Tree
Complete Binary Search Tree
二叉搜索树的操作集
第五讲 树(下)
堆中的路径
File Transfer
Huffman Codes
第六讲 图(上)
列出连通集
Saving James Bond - Easy Version
六度空间
第七讲 图(中)
哈利·波特的考试
Saving James Bond - Hard Version
旅游规划
第八讲 图(下)
公路村村通
How Long Does It Take
关键活动【有2个测试点无法通过】
第九讲 排序(上)
排序
Insert or Merge
Insertion or Heap Sort